Abstract
Objective:
2
To observe the imbalance of anatomical and functional innervation factors of sympathetic nerves
nerve growth factor (NGF) and leukemia inhibitory factor (LIF)
in salt-sensitive hypertensive heart failure rats and to explore the effects of treatment with Guizhi Decoction (桂枝汤) on sympathetic remodeling by inhibiting cholinergic transdifferentiation.
Methods:
2
SS-13
BN
and Dahl salt-sensitive (DS) rats were divided into 3 groups: SS-13
BN
group (control group
n
=9)
DS group (model group
n
=9) and GS group (Guizhi Decoction
n
=9). After 10 weeks of a high-salt diet
the GS group rats were given Guizhi Decoction and other two groups were given saline at an equal volume as a vehicle. After 4 weeks' intragastric administration
rats were executed to detect the relevant indicators. Echocardiography and plasma n-terminal pro-B type natriuretic peptide (NT-proBNP) levels were used to assess cardiac function. Noradrenaline (NA) levels in the plasma and myocardium were detected to evaluate the sympathetic function. NGF and LIF expression were detected in the myocardium by Western blot or quantitative real-time PCR. Double immunofluorescence or Western blot was used to detect tyrosine hydroxylase (TH)
choline acetyltransferase (CHAT) and growth associated protein 43 (GAP43) in order to reflect anatomical and functional changes of sympathetic nerves.
Results:
2
DS group had anatomical and functional deterioration of sympathetic nerves in the decompensation period of heart failure compared with SS-13
BN
group. Compared with the DS group
Guizhi Decoction significantly decreased the expression of LIF mRNA/protein (
P
<
0.01)
increased the expression of NGF (
P
<
0.05 or
P
<
0.01)
enhanced the levels of TH
+
/GAP43
+
and TH
+
/CHAT
+
positive nerve fibers (
P
<
0.01)
and improved the protein expression of TH and GAP43 in left ventricle
but had no effect on CHAT (
P
>
0.05). Guizhi Decoction inhibited inflammatory infiltration and collagen deposition of myocardial injury
increased the content of myocardial NA (
P
<
0.05)
reduced the plasma NA level (
P
<
0.01)
improved cardiac function (
P
<
0.01)
and improved weight and blood pressure to some extent (
P
<
0.05)
compared with DS group.
Conclusions:
2
Guizhi Decoction could inhibit cholinergic transdifferentiation of sympathetic nerves
improve the anatomical and functional denervation of sympathetic nerves
and delay the progression of decompensated heart failure. The mechanism may be associated with the correction of the imbalance of NGF and LIF.
